Search Engine Optimization and Local Search Engine Optimization Services
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is the method of making a website more visible in search results. Google considers hundreds of factors to determine which websites are relevant to a particular search. The information is then compiled to create search results. The algorithm that evaluates relevancy and prominence as well as link populatility determines which websites rank highest. Optimizing a website’s digital footprint can boost its prominence, relevancy, and link populatility and increase the number of search results.
Search Engine Optimization aims to increase website traffic through organic search results. The aim of SEO is to get on the top spot of Google’s search results. Local SEO concentrates on the geo-related aspects of searches and aims to improve the visibility and organic traffic for local businesses. Local SEO improves local website visibility and also increases foot traffic to brick and mortar businesses. It is simpler to rank highly for local searches because competition is lower than for keywords that have online buying intent. Local SEO is also completely free.
